Where each one falls short
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.
eClinicalWorks Prime
- EHR Only is $449/month per provider and EHR with Practice Management is $599/month per provider, priced per provider rather than a flat practice fee
- The RCM as a Service option charges 2.9% of practice collections rather than a fixed fee
- Practices with more than 9 providers are charged additional implementation fees beyond the included training
Zocdoc
- Doctors can cancel appointments with little notice
- No direct messaging between patients and providers outside of appointment booking
- Providers incur booking fees even if patients no-show or cancel after 24 hours

SourceZocdoc: Is Zocdoc free for patients?
Yes, searching for and booking appointments on Zocdoc is completely free for patients. There are no search fees, booking fees, or cancellation fees. Patients only pay their insurance copay or self-pay rate for the actual care.
SourceeClinicalWorks Prime: How can you get eClinicalWorks Prime pricing?
Contact eClinicalWorks directly at 508-836-2700 to speak with their sales team or schedule a demo to discuss pricing tailored to your organization.
SourceZocdoc: Does Zocdoc verify that doctors accept my insurance?
Zocdoc supports over 1,000 insurance plans and filters results to show only providers who accept your specific plan. However, Zocdoc cannot guarantee in-network status, as plans with similar names can differ by employer group or region. Final verification is always confirmed by your insurer and the provider's office.
SourceZocdoc: What specialties and types of providers does Zocdoc cover?
Zocdoc features a network of over 250,000 providers across 200+ specialties, including primary care physicians, dentists, OB-GYNs, dermatologists, psychiatrists, eye doctors, orthopedic surgeons, and therapists.
SourceZocdoc: How much do providers pay to use Zocdoc?
Zocdoc charges healthcare providers a one-time booking fee per new patient, with pricing varying by specialty and local market. The exact fee is quoted individually to practices.
